Very Good Phone

 

Mar 5, 2008 by merc669

Have had the Z6c for about a week and overall I am very pleased with it. There are still some lingering questions as far as how it will work overseas with a 3rd party SIM. But overall a very fine phone compared to my old RAZR.

Pros;
Very good phone connections compared to my old RAZR. Clear on both ends
Slider appears to be sturdy and well built so far.
Good Bluetooth Connections and ability to talk and listen.
Good Menu Selection with keys positioned well.
Voice Activation for phone positioned better compared to RAZR to prevent accidental selection.
Very nice Camera (2 MP)but No Flash
SIM - No real problem installing or removing
Battery life has been good so far

Cons;
MicroSD Memory appears to be a bit of a pain to install
No Flash on Camera (No Biggie for Me)
Does pickup finger-prints and smearing on screen easily

Overall; Very fine job by Motorola and Verizon for offering a relatively in-expensive global phone to compete with ATT and T-Mobil. Now if the 3rd party SIM's work when I try it here soon then they have a winner in the Z6c!


Great phone

 

Feb 15, 2008 by macgyverh

Upgraded from a Razr 3m that looked cool but got poor reception in comparison to my previous phone, a Motorola E815. The E815 was the best cell phone that I have had until I received the Z6c.

Pros

- the construction is very solid with a super smooth slider mechanism that locks with a switch on the side, locking not only the slider but the keys for prevention of accidental activation

- the design is great with a large, sharp, clear display, side buttons where they should be, and ability to answer and send calls from the contact list without sliding the phone open are nice features

- sound quality is great

- signal strength is the best that I have experienced in my area with EVDO and 1x

- dual band capabilities will be appreciated with travel outside the US although this functionality has not been tested yet in my use of the phone

- back of phone is tactile to touch so that it does not slide so easily off of surfaces - nice touch

- BlueTooth set-up worked great and gives a very good signal with my BlueTooth earpiece

- keypad layout is tactile with large enough keys and adequate spacing that dialing is not a problem even with reflection on keypad in strong light

Cons

- choose between vibrate or ring; bring back the vibrate and then ring feature that was standard on previous Motorola phones

- microUSB connector requires purchasing of miniUSB to microUSB convertors for spare charger and car charger; great for third parties who make some money on these necessities but a pain for an owner

- headphone adaptor requires USB dongle that is included with phone but must be carried if headphones are to be used

- keypad is shiny and reflects too much light in bright sunshine but otherwise works well

Not Evaluated
- music function - do not use so have not tried it

Recommendation

If you like Motorola phones, get this one as your next one.


Awesome Phone

 

Jan 23, 2008 by innout203

Got the phone from Alltel's U prepaid service. So if you have bad credit and dont want to pay a huge deposit you can still get a great phone. You dont even have to be 18. I live in Yuma AZ. and the signal is fantastic.

PROS:
small and stylish (slider)

great 2.0 megapixel camera with video.

MP3 player is so easy to use

bluetooth works like a charm

Not slow like the razor or krazor.

Micro USB is right on top of phone.

Battery life is fantastic...

CONS:
Not really a con, but the speaker could be a little louder.

the buttons are crammed together so you sometime make a mistake and exit out of something. Other than those two I cant find anything else that would stop you from getting this phone. ITS GREAT!!!!


An Excellent Phone that needs some tweaking

 

Jan 2, 2008 by djl31065

Pros
Reception is excellent and the earpiece is extremely clear. Callers cannot tell that I am calling from a mobile phone. This phone gets signals in locations I have unable been able to use with some of my previous handsets.

The phone has a solid feel and the slider is smooth and easy to use. The display is very bright. In fact, I reduced the brightness two levels, in order to preserve battery life. I especially like the slide switch for the keyboard lock.

The speaker independent voice dialing works flawlessly.

Even though the speakerphone volume is on the low side, callers were unable to tell that I switched to speakerphone.

I purchased the Global Pack from Verizon. They claim they will be able to provide an unlock code for the SIM card in about six weeks.

Cons
The SIM slot is extremely difficult to reach. If you have a Micro SD card installed, it must be removed in order to get to the SIM card.

The speakerphone is clear but the volume slightly on the low side. I also wish the handset volume can be increased by one or two levels. Perhaps Moto will address this in future firmware updates.

Battery life with the standard battery is too short. I will need to upgrade to the extended battery.
